I'm just looking for some speculation on how long do you think they're going to continue the one new/one re-release table pack trend.

According to the official announced table page, they're only four more HOF releases on it that have yet to be given release time frames. They are Pinbot, Whirlwind, Space Shuttle and Victory.

The other unannounced HOF tables are Ace High, Central Park, Tee'd Off, Goin' Nuts, Ed Dorado, Strikes N' Spares and the 1932 Play-boy from The Gottlieb Collection and just Sorcerer and Jive Time from The Williams Collection.
